## Broker Upgrade Context

We are upgrading the Quillbus message broker from 4.2 to 5.0 across the Harwick cluster. The rollout is staged: consumers first, then brokers one node at a time, with replication verified between each step. Please review the compatibility notes before the sync and flag any consumer groups pinned to old protocol versions. Questions before Thursday should go to the upgrade coordinator at the address below.

alerts address for bawif-hahig: norwyn_gorys_lamath@olvarqlabs.test

The Orvane Labs bike cage and the east and west parking gates operate on separate access schedules, and facilities desk staff should note that visitor vehicles may only use the west gate between 07:00 and 19:00. Cyclists requesting cage access must show a valid day pass, and their details should be entered in the access ledger before the cage is opened. Gates must never be propped open, even briefly, during deliveries. When a manual override is required at either gate, use the code below.

staff pass of fadup-fawig = bdg-FUNKS-4

## Per-Tenant Rate Quotas

Every plugin operating on the Hollowgate platform is subject to per-tenant rate quotas. The default allowance is 600 requests per minute per tenant, with burst headroom of 20%. Quota state is queried from the internal Meterhall service; responses include remaining capacity and reset time. Plugins exceeding a quota receive a 429 with a retry hint. Test quota behavior against the Meterhall sandbox using the key below.

gateway credential: zpat15_lMLOSdhT94y0U3l

Runbook: account recovery — Stagefront seat-map renderer

Support folks: if a venue admin is locked out of the seat-map editor, first check that their session isn't just stuck on a stale layout draft (happens a lot with the Orpheum Hall template). If it's a genuine lockout, open the recovery console and reset their editor token. The console will prompt for the recovery passphrase below.

unlock words, kawig-bawef: belax-sorir-druax-ulaiel-wenael-belael